Starting system management services from a nonpartitioned server

Learn how to start system management services (SMS) menus using the Advanced System Management Interface (ASMI), the control panel, or from the AIX® operating system.

Starting the SMS menus from the ASMI

If the ASMI is available on a network-attached console and the system is in standby, perform the following steps:
  1. On the ASMI Welcome window, specify your user ID and password, and click Log In.
  2. In the navigation area, expand Power/Restart Control and select Power On/Off System.
  3. Click Save settings and continue system server firmware boot.
  4. Look for the POST indicators memory, keyboard, network, scsi, speaker, which display across the bottom of the firmware console. For details, see Power-on self-test keys.
  5. Press the numeric 1 key after the word keyboard is displayed and before the word speaker is displayed.
  6. If requested, accept the firmware agreement
  7. If requested, select a language. For details on the available languages, see Selecting the language in system management services.
  8. If requested, enter a password. Enter the admin password that you set during initial system setup.

Starting the SMS menus when the ASMI is not available and the system is in standby

If the ASMI is not available and the system is in standby, complete the following steps:
  1. Press the power button on the control panel.
  2. Look for the POST indicators memory, keyboard, network, scsi, speaker, which display across the bottom of the firmware console. For details, see Power-on self-test keys.
  3. Press the numeric 1 key after the word keyboard is displayed and before the word speaker is displayed.
  4. If requested, accept the firmware agreement
  5. If requested, select a language. For details on the available languages, see Selecting the language in system management services.
  6. If requested, enter a password. Enter the admin password that you set during initial system setup.
